Michael Garrett may refer to: Michael Garrett (astronomer) (born 1964), General Director of the Dutch astronomy research foundation ASTRON, Michael Garrett (composer) (born 1944), British composer, Michael Tlanusta Garrett (author), Mike Garrett (born 1944), American football player, Mike Garrett (soccer) (born 1961), retired American soccer player, Mick Garrett (born 1937), Irish Gaelic footballer

Source: Wikipedia

Text from this biography licensed under creative commons license